Butternut Squash Soup with Leftover Turkey

Great way to use your leftover Thanksgiving turkey - just add to butternut squash soup after cooking and puree. You can adjust the amount of turkey depending on your leftovers.

Recipe Instructions

Step 1
Melt butter in a large saucepan over medium heat and cool onions until soft and translucent, about 3 minutes. Add butternut squash, water, beef bouillon, marjoram, pepper, and cayenne; bring to a boil. Cook until butternut squash is tender, about 25 minutes.
Step 2
Add turkey and cream cheese to the saucepan with the butternut squash mixture.
Step 3
Pour soup in batches into a blender or food processor; blend until smooth. Return to saucepan and heat through, about 5 minutes, but do not let soup boil.

Ingredients

  • ¼ te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
  • 16 ounces cream cheese
  • ⅔ cup chopped onion
  • ⅛ teaspoon ground cayenne pepper
  • 4 cubes beef bouillon
  • 4 ½ cups water
  • ¾ teaspoon dried marjoram
  • ⅜ cup unsalted butter
  • 48 ounces butternut squash, peeled and cubed
  • 3 pounds leftover roasted turkey
